    Frequently Asked Questions about Digital Transformation

    • Digital transformation is the process of creating new opportunities for innovation in business processes and products by utilizing digital technologies such as mobile phones, cloud computing, and information technology (IT). Having a savvy digital transformation strategy is important for companies in every industry, whether they are seeking to protect their existing market share, expand into new markets, or create entirely new business models.

      For example, the use of financial technology (or “fintech”) in the financing industry has enabled new products and services such as online lending, e-commerce, and cryptocurrencies. Audio streaming services have caused no less than a total technology disruption of the music industry, supplanting music sales with subscription-based services. And in education, online platforms like Coursera are working with existing universities and businesses to expand access to learning opportunities.‎

    • Every business needs to be aware of the opportunities and challenges that digital transformation brings to their industry. Though each department will interact with digital technologies in their own way, IT departments are usually most directly responsible for implementing changes, integrating new processes, and creating new products.

      With digital innovations spanning such a wide-ranging and ever-changing frontier, organizations often rely on experienced strategic management consultants to guide them through the digital transformation.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, management analysts make a median salary of $85,260 per year, and their job growth is expected to be much faster than the average for all occupations due to the growing need for advisory services on digital strategy and other areas.‎

    • The skills and experience that you might need to already have before starting to learn digital transformation involve having a strong interest in technology and its impact on business, life, and society. Technology disruptions over the past 25 years have changed the way that businesses operate, and digital transformation concerns adapting to new digital processes to increase efficiency and keep up with industry-accepted practices overall. Having knowledge of markets, understanding the fundamental economics of industries, and being passionate about digital technologies are just a few of the skills and experience that would help you to learn digital transformation.‎

    • The kind of people who are best suited for work that involves digital transformation are often people who are detail-oriented with a keen operational focus, leadership abilities, and a wide-ranging knowledge of change management theories. Because digital transformation acts as the guiding strategy for organizations to move through during a period of significant operational change, it means that the people leading the evolution should be wise, disciplined, technology-focused, and have good knowledge of business conditions and outlook for the particular industry.‎
